ID Center

ID Center

Overview

ID Center는 고객이 운영하는 자격 증명 공급자와 연계하여 Samsung Cloud Platform 의 Account 별 자원에 대한 접근 권한을 중앙에서 손쉽게 관리할 수 있는 서비스입니다. 본 가이드는 IAM 서비스에 대한 간략한 설명 및 API를 호출하는 방법을 제공합니다. API는 RESTful API 방식으로 제공되며, JSON 형식으로 응답합니다.

Version

Not Before 기간이 도래하거나 만료된 Deprecated 버전은 더 이상 지원하지 않습니다. 최신 버전 사용을 권장합니다.

VersionStatusNot Before
1.4CURRENT-
1.3SUPPORTED20261130
1.2SUPPORTED20260930
1.1DEPRECATED20260531
1.0DEPRECATED20260223

OpenAPI URL

https://iam-identity-center.{region}.{environment}.samsungsdscloud.com

Environment and Region List

environmentregion
skr-west1
skr-east1
gkr-south1
gkr-south2
gkr-south3
ekr-west1
ekr-east1

API Version History

1.4

API Version History - v1.4

iam-identity-center 서비스의 OpenAPI 관련 변경 사항이 없습니다.

이전 버전: v1.3 → 현재 버전: v1.4

변경사항

  • 변경사항 없음

1.3

API Version History - v1.3

iam-identity-center 서비스의 OpenAPI 변경 사항입니다.

이전 버전: v1.2 → 현재 버전: v1.3

변경사항

  • [변경] GET /instances/{instance_id} - 인스턴스 상세 조회 응답에 공용 IP(public_ip)와 포트(port) 정보가 추가되었습니다.

1.2

API Version History - v1.2

iam-identity-center 서비스의 OpenAPI 변경 사항입니다.

이전 버전: v1.1 → 현재 버전: v1.2

변경사항

  • [변경] POST /account-assignments -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] GET /instances - 인스턴스 목록 조회 요청 형식이 변경되었습니다.
  • [변경] GET /permission-sets -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] POST /permission-sets -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] GET /permission-sets/{permission_set_id} -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] PATCH /permission-sets/{permission_set_id} -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] GET /permission-sets/{permission_set_id}/policies - 고객 정의형 정책 필드명이 변경되었습니다.
  • [변경] PUT /permission-sets/{permission_set_id}/policies - 고객 정의형 정책 필드명이 변경되었습니다.

1.1

API Version History - v1.1

Active Directory 인스턴스 유형이 추가되었습니다.

이전 버전: v1.0 → 현재 버전: v1.1

변경사항

  • [변경] POST / - 응답 모델이 업데이트되었습니다.
  • [변경] GET /<instance_id> - OPENAPI 범위에 포함되었으며, 응답 모델이 업데이트되었습니다.
  • [변경] PATCH /<instance_id> - 요청 모델 및 응답 모델이 업데이트되고, OPENAPI 범위에 포함되었습니다.

1.0

API Version History - v1.0

iam-identity-center 서비스의 최초 OpenAPI 릴리스입니다.

초기 버전

변경사항

  • [신규] GET /account-assignments - 계정 할당 목록 조회 API가 추가되었습니다.
  • [신규] POST /account-assignments - 계정 할당 생성 API가 추가되었습니다.
  • [신규] DELETE /account-assignments - 계정 할당 벌크 삭제 API가 추가되었습니다.
  • [신규] DELETE /account-assignments/{account_assignment_id} - 특정 계정 할당 삭제 API가 추가되었습니다.
  • [신규] GET /account-assignments/permission-sets - 계정 할당 권한 세트 목록 API가 추가되었습니다.
  • [신규] GET /instances - 인스턴스 목록 조회 API가 추가되었습니다.
  • [신규] POST /instances - 인스턴스 생성 API가 추가되었습니다.
  • [신규] GET /instances/{instance_id} - 인스턴스 상세 조회 API가 추가되었습니다.
  • [신규] PATCH /instances/{instance_id} - 인스턴스 수정 API가 추가되었습니다.
  • [신규] DELETE /instances/{instance_id} - 인스턴스 삭제 API가 추가되었습니다.
  • [신규] GET /groups - 그룹 목록 조회 API가 추가되었습니다.
  • [신규] POST /groups - 그룹 생성 API가 추가되었습니다.
  • [신규] DELETE /groups - 그룹 벌크 삭제 API가 추가되었습니다.
  • [신규] GET /groups/{group_id} - 그룹 상세 조회 API가 추가되었습니다.
  • [신규] PATCH /groups/{group_id} - 그룹 수정 API가 추가되었습니다.
  • [신규] DELETE /groups/{group_id} - 그룹 삭제 API가 추가되었습니다.
  • [신규] GET /users - 사용자 목록 조회 API가 추가되었습니다.
  • [신규] POST /users - 사용자 생성 API가 추가되었습니다.
  • [신규] DELETE /users - 사용자 벌크 삭제 API가 추가되었습니다.
  • [신규] GET /users/{user_uuid} - 사용자 상세 조회 API가 추가되었습니다.
  • [신규] PATCH /users/{user_uuid} - 사용자 수정 API가 추가되었습니다.
  • [신규] DELETE /users/{user_uuid} - 사용자 삭제 API가 추가되었습니다.
  • [신규] GET /permission-sets - 권한 세트 목록 조회 API가 추가되었습니다.
  • [신규] POST /permission-sets - 권한 세트 생성 API가 추가되었습니다.
  • [신규] DELETE /permission-sets - 권한 세트 벌크 삭제 API가 추가되었습니다.
  • [신규] GET /permission-sets/{permission_set_id} - 권한 세트 상세 조회 API가 추가되었습니다.
  • [신규] PATCH /permission-sets/{permission_set_id} - 권한 세트 수정 API가 추가되었습니다.
  • [신규] DELETE /permission-sets/{permission_set_id} - 권한 세트 삭제 API가 추가되었습니다.